How do I start an integration between Heap Analytics and Jandi?

To start, connect both your Heap Analytics and Jandi accounts to viaSocket. Once connected, you can set up a workflow where an event in Heap Analytics triggers actions in Jandi (or vice versa).

Can we customize how data from Heap Analytics is recorded in Jandi?

Absolutely. You can customize how Heap Analytics data is recorded in Jandi. This includes choosing which data fields go into which fields of Jandi, setting up custom formats, and filtering out unwanted information.

How often does the data sync between Heap Analytics and Jandi?

The data sync between Heap Analytics and Jandi typically happens in real-time through instant triggers. And a maximum of 15 minutes in case of a scheduled trigger.

Can I filter or transform data before sending it from Heap Analytics to Jandi?

Yes, viaSocket allows you to add custom logic or use built-in filters to modify data according to your needs.

Is it possible to add conditions to the integration between Heap Analytics and Jandi?

Yes, you can set conditional logic to control the flow of data between Heap Analytics and Jandi. For instance, you can specify that data should only be sent if certain conditions are met, or you can create if/else statements to manage different outcomes.

About Heap Analytics

Heap Analytics collects and analyzes user event data to understand how users interact with a product.

About Jandi

Jandi is a powerful team collaboration platform designed to enhance communication and productivity within organizations. It offers features like group messaging, file sharing, and task management, making it an ideal solution for teams looking to streamline their workflows and improve collaboration.
